A 35-year-old man pleaded guilty to a case of "drunk driving" in the Kwun Tong Magistracy this morning (26th) and was released on bail awaiting sentence, during which he was not allowed to drive.

Unexpectedly, someone drove a private car of a leveling rule right after stepping out of the court. As a result, they were intercepted by the police in front of the court. They were judged on the spot and were arrested again for "violation of bail conditions." The case will appear in Kwun Tong Magistrates' Courts tomorrow.

The police said that at 12 noon today, officers from the Special Task Force of the East Kowloon Region carried out operations against driving during the suspension period and intercepted vehicles suspected of driving during the suspension period.

During the operation, officers stopped a 35-year-old driver with the surname Mo. After investigation, it is believed that he had been released on bail and awaiting sentence for admitting a case of "drunk driving" earlier the same day, during which he was not allowed to drive.

The police then arrested the male driver for "violating bail conditions". The case will appear in Kwun Tong Magistrates' Courts tomorrow morning.

It is understood that Mo Nan was accused of "driving under the influence" earlier and appeared in Kwun Tong Magistracy this morning. He pleaded guilty to the charge and was released on bail awaiting sentencing. During the period, he was suspended from driving. However, someone left the court and drove immediately. The Pingzhi private car immediately encountered police action on the eastbound lane of Kwun Tong Road off Kwun Tong Court and broke straight on the spot.
